10 Years at Rogers. Laid off. Replaced by HCL India. Here's my story.
I gave Rogers 10 years of my career. Last month I received a severance letter stating my "position has been eliminated."
What they didn't say: the same work is now being performed by HCL Technologies, an Indian IT outsourcing firm, under a different job title.
I'm one of approximately 150 Canadians let go in this wave while Rogers quietly offshores the same roles to cut costs. The title changes. The work doesn't.
This isn't restructuring. This is cost arbitrage disguised as elimination.
Rogers collected 10 years of my institutional knowledge, my loyalty through mergers and reorgs, and then discarded me the moment a cheaper option appeared overseas.
The federal government has no policy requiring companies to prove genuine role elimination before issuing severance. The loophole is the title change,same duties, new name, offshore team.
If you're a Rogers employee reading this: document everything now. Your job title, your duties, your team structure. If your role gets "eliminated" while a contractor from HCL picks up your tasks next quarter, that is not elimination. That is replacement.
